Botafogo Rout Vasco 3-0 to Climb to Sixth and Bolster Libertadores Bid

The result lifts Botafogo to 51 points in sixth place, strengthening their pursuit of a 2026 Copa Libertadores spot.

Overview

  • Alex Telles opened the scoring from the spot after Joaquín Correa won a penalty in first-half stoppage time.
  • Artur doubled the lead on a counterattack set up by Savarino before a third was recorded as a Léo Jardim own goal off a David Ricardo header.
  • Botafogo controlled the derby at Nilton Santos, generating a flurry of early chances including ten shots within the first half hour.
  • The win followed two successive draws and tightened Botafogo’s grip on a top-seven position, the threshold for Libertadores qualification.
  • This was Botafogo’s final classic of 2025 after their Copa do Brasil exit, with the team next visiting Vitória on November 8.
